Anything that gets saved in this application gets sync with every platform you use.īesides, the app really shines with the other G suite products like Google Drive, Docs, Slides, Calendars, and Sheets etc. You can save images, URLs and text using Google Keep Chrome extension as and when you browse the web. This app offers an easy way to write down notes, it allows you to add images, write and even draw.
